The Position: Provides high quality bilingual customer service as well as maintain strong professional relationships while supporting our customer’s, Sales Team, and internal departments. This position is responsible for handling orders, investigating, and resolving customer inquiries in a knowledgeable, professional, and personal manner. The Customer Experience Representative contributes to the service levels of our Montreal branch as well as the profitability of Trudell Healthcare Solutions Inc. by providing insights into customer order exceptions and working to eliminate obstacles to order fulfilment.

Since 1922, Trudell Healthcare Solutions Inc., a member of the Trudell Medical Group, has been a stable and financially sound Canadian-based employer, headquartered in London, Ontario. For over 100 years, we have enjoyed the reputation of being successful and trustworthy in the eyes of our customers, our suppliers and our staff. We are passionate about selling, servicing and distributing technologically advanced Critical Care and Respiratory products and state-of-the-art Operating Room products to hospitals across Canada.
